webbuilders-group / silverstripe-vidyard-embed
为 SilverStripe 添加支持,轻松将 Vidyard 视频嵌入到您由 SilverStripe 驱动的网站上。
0.4.1
2017-03-14 15:00 UTC
Requires
- silverstripe/framework: ~3.1
README
为 SilverStripe 添加支持,轻松将 Vidyard 视频嵌入到您由 SilverStripe 驱动的网站上。
维护者联系方式
- Ed Chipman (UndefinedOffset)
需求
- SilverStripe 框架 3.1+
安装
Composer(推荐)
composer require webbuilders-group/silverstripe-vidyard-embed
如果您愿意,也可以手动安装
- 从这里下载模块 https://github.com/webbuilders-group/silverstripe-vidyard-embed/archive/master.zip
- 将下载的存档提取到您的网站根目录中,以便目标文件夹名为 kapost-bridge,提取的文件夹应该包含根目录中的 _config.php 以及其他文件/文件夹
- 运行 dev/build?flush=all 以重新生成清单
使用方法
此模块提供了一个名为“来自 Vidyard”的新插入媒体选项,其功能与“来自 Web”非常相似,但它专门针对 Vidyard,目前不支持 oEmbed。此字段中预期的链接是“分享页面”或一些设置页面,包括嵌入选择页面(有关详细信息,请参阅文档)。您将需要一个 Vidyard 的 API 密钥,因为它用于查找嵌入所需的信息,请参阅这里有关获取此密钥的信息。一旦您从 Vidyard 获得API密钥,用户密钥就足够了。在使用此模块添加 Vidyard 视频之前,您必须将以下内容添加到您的配置中。
Vidyard: api_key: "YOUR_API_KEY_HERE" #Vidyard API Key
如果您愿意,也可以使用以下语法手动将此简码添加到您的 WYSIWYG 中,所有参数都是可选的。
[vidyard,width="600",height="480",class="leftAlone",thumbnail="URL_FOR_THUMBNAIL"]URL_FOR_VIDEO[/vidyard]